Output ddcf862e6920c4f5dccc1cd4037526309f680cfbf96bfb0386a5a9f9375a223a:0

value
66828754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 645e21618fba2fdc82c3920c5dbbd9accd1046c1 OP_EQUAL
address
3AqiG2BtLge17832VeEbotujrsSG1PSHUz
transaction
ddcf862e6920c4f5dccc1cd4037526309f680cfbf96bfb0386a5a9f9375a223a
spent
true